Django 02. Django框架之基礎

簡介
        
        建立django程序的兩種方式、django經常使用命令及makemigrations與migrate詳解、django配置文件經常使用4處修改項。

建立django程序python


    1. django-admin startproject sitename
    2. 或者用IDE中的圖形界面操做

django經常使用命令
 
    python manage.py runserver 127.0.0.1:9000
    python manage.py startapp appname
    python manage.py makemigrations 
    python manage.py migrate
 
    說明: 執行makemigrations 後,會在migrations 目錄下記錄models.py的全部改動,並生成SQL語句,可是此時尚未把數據寫入數據庫,只有當執行了migrate時數據纔會寫入數據庫。

配置文件經常使用修改項
 
 
    DATABAES = {
        'default':{
        'ENGINE':'django.db.backends.mysql',
        'NAME':'dbname',
        'USER':'root',
        'PASSWORD':'xxx',
        'HOST': '127.0.0.1'
        'PORT':'3306',
   }
}
 
    2,模板
 
    TEMPLATE_DIRS = (
    os.path.join(BASE_DIR,'templates'),
)
 
 
    STATICFILES_DIRS  = (
        os.path.join(BASE_DIR,'static'),
)
 
 
LANGUAGE_CODE = 'zh-hans'
TIME_ZONE = 'Asia/Shanghai'
USE_I18N = True
USE_L10N = True
USE_TZ = False
相關文章
相關標籤/搜索